A gentle yet powerful anti-ageing laser facial. The Cutera Laser Genesis safely heats the dermis by pulsing micro-beams of laser energy onto the skin.

How many Laser Genesis treatments will I need and how often can I have treatment?
We usually recommend a course of 6 treatments performed every 2-6 weeks. -
How much downtime is there with a Laser Genesis treatment?
There is minimal downtime after this facial – the skin is usually warm and slightly pink straight afterwards. The redness subsides within a few hours and mineral makeup can be applied immediately afterwards. -

Is Laser Genesis good for pigmentation?
Laser Genesis doesn’t specifically treat pigmentation, however it will brighten the overall complexion of your skin. -
Is Laser Genesis good for rosacea?
Yes, a course of Laser Genesis along with a tailored homecare routine has significantly improve the appearance of rosacea. -

What are the benefits of Laser Genesis?
Reduces overall redness, improves texture, refines enlarged pores and stimulates collagen and elastin which is great for overall antiaging. -
What can I expect from my Laser Genesis treatment?
Our Laser Genesis treatments involves a gentle exfoliation from the lactic peel, gentle stimulation by the laser and hydration of the Crystal Fibre Mask. The skin will be left feeling revived, plump, tight and glowing. -

What is the aftercare for a Laser Genesis?
No actives for 48 hours, wear SPF and keep the skin cool. For best results, we recommend to use your prescribed homecare in between sessions. -
What skin types can have Laser Genesis?
All skin types can have Laser Genesis! -
What’s the difference between the Laser Genesis signature and lite?
Laser Genesis Signature and Lite both include a Lactic Peel and a Crystal Fibre Mask. The Signature treatment treats the full face while the Lite is concentrating on only half of the face to treat a area of concern (usually the nose and cheeks) -
What wavelength does Laser Genesis work on?
The Cutera Laser Genesis uses 1064nm.
